SummaryPolicy-based governance for AI agent tool calls. YAML policies, approval gates, risk assessment, and audit logging. Cross-platform: LangChain, OpenAI, Anthropic, MCP.Local-only GitHub Actions and CI maintenance scanner for AI-built apps. Exposes scanrepo, explainfinding, and generatefixplan to MCP clients; reads only allowlisted workflow and update configuration, modifies nothing, makes no outbound requests by default, and has zero runtime dependencies. Run with npx -y taskbounty-check@0.1.6 mcp.
